China Boton Group Company Limited released unaudited interim results for the six months ended 30 June 2026.
Financial Highlights • Revenue rose 25.3% year on year to RMB798.84 million (≈ 0.80 billion). • Gross profit increased 17.2% to RMB233.14 million; gross margin narrowed to 29.2% from 31.2%. • Operating profit advanced 13.3% to RMB38.21 million, yet net profit attributable to shareholders fell to a loss of RMB29.96 million; total net profit for the period dropped 74.5% to RMB2.22 million. • Basic loss per share widened to RMB0.03 versus RMB0.01 a year earlier. • No interim dividend was declared.
Segment Performance (external revenue) • e-Cigarette Products: RMB422.45 million (+58.1% YoY), accounting for 52.9% of group revenue. • Tobacco Flavors: RMB165.24 million (-7.9%), 20.7% share. • Food Flavors: RMB115.64 million (+24.3%), 14.5% share. • Fine Fragrances: RMB77.15 million (+5.5%), 9.6% share. • Investment Properties: RMB18.36 million (-26.2%), 2.3% share.
Cost & Expenses Total cost of sales, selling & marketing, and administrative expenses climbed 25.8% to RMB766.98 million, driven by higher raw-material usage (+31.0%) and depreciation/amortisation (+43.8%). Selling and marketing costs rose 34.6% to RMB33.51 million, while administrative expenses grew 14.7% to RMB167.77 million. Net finance costs increased 17.6% to RMB26.91 million due to exchange losses.
Balance Sheet & Liquidity • Total assets: RMB6.77 billion (31 Dec 2025: RMB6.80 billion). • Equity attributable to owners: RMB2.02 billion (-3.9% from year-end). • Cash and cash equivalents plus restricted cash: RMB1.57 billion. • Total borrowings fell to RMB1.16 billion from RMB2.20 billion; debt-to-equity ratio improved to 48.3% (31 Dec 2025: 92.1%). • Reported net current liabilities of RMB322.14 million reflect RMB2.49 billion land-resumption compensation temporarily booked as other payables; adjusting for this item, net current assets stand at roughly RMB2.05 billion and the current ratio at 3.41.
Key Corporate Developments • Shenzhen Land Resumption: Compensation of RMB2.49 billion fully received; transaction completed in July 2026 and recorded as a current payable at period-end. • M&A: On 30 June 2026, subsidiary Boton (Shanghai) Bio-tech agreed to acquire 100% of Shanghai Longyin Biotechnology for RMB240.00 million; RMB160.00 million paid by August 2026. Completion pending registration. • Share Buy-back: 5.57 million shares repurchased during May–June 2026 for HK$12.99 million; held as treasury shares. • Litigation: Multiple ongoing cases related to the 2016 Kimree acquisition; RMB150.00 million payable accrued.
Outlook Management will prioritise regulatory compliance in e-Cigarette operations, continue investing in product innovation, and diversify markets. Proceeds from the Shenzhen land compensation and reduced leverage offer flexibility for R&D expansion and potential investments.
